Watch and Act - Gum Scrub
(Port Macquarie-Hastings LGA)
Posted:09/11/2019 13:14
A bush fire is burning in the Cooperabung area. The fire is 750
hectares and is out of control.
Current Situation
The fire is burning north of the Wilson River, in the Cooperabung
and Telegraph Point area.
Firefighters continue working to establish containment lines
around the fire.
Advice
If you are in the area of Telegraph Point, monitor
conditions.
Know what you will do if the fire threatens. Check and refresh
your bush fire survival plan.
